    I added FC3 support to the EasyFlash 2 already in 2010. The sources are freely available for everybody who needs them (search for MODE_FC3):

    Bitte melde dich an, um diesen Link zu sehen.

    There are still some remains in some EF3 sources even:
    Bitte melde dich an, um diesen Link zu sehen.

    I ported it to EF3 too, but never released it because of the CPLD space issue and because I didn't want to maintain two CPLD images. Since the EF2 and EF3 are very similar, it's quite easy to port it.

    Peto74, yes, you have the same rights to use the EF2/EF3 sources as Unseen. You can derive a new work from it and release it for free or for money, whatever you want. As long as you fulfill the license terms, of course. For example you are not allowed to release modified source code w/o marking it as modified by you. Just read the license boiler plate carefully.

  • The SD Commander v5.0 is the independent program, it has nothing with FC3. I have created it for my own use in the year 2014 (last update , version 5.0). And it is for me very useful. And yes, it works with SD2IEC as well. By default, it uses KERNAL routines for loading (slow), but you can press the key L and the fastloader routines will be activated. Pressing Shift-L you can activate back the KERNAL routines.
    The current state you can see in the right upper corner.

    I have been working on adding FC3 support to the EF3 and got something that seems to work reliably. The CPLD was pretty crammed so I had to do some optimizations and shortcuts, and the FC3+ (256 kbyte ROM) is not supported.
